Abstract

A találmány tárgya eljárás (I) általános képletű vegyületek - amelyekképletében R1 hidrogénatom vagy alkilcsoport; R2 hidrogénatom, alkil-, cikloalkil- vagy -CH2B csoport; Het adott esetben szubsztituált heterociklusos csoport; és B jelentése adott esetben szubsztituált fenil-, 3-piridil- vagytiazolilcsoport - és ahol lehetséges a vegyületek E/Z<>-izomereinek,E/Z-izomerkeverékeinek és/vagy tautomereinek szabad formában vagy sóformában történő előállítására, amelynek során egy (IIa) általánosképletű vegyületet Q-A-Q (IIa) vagy egy (IIb) általános képletűvegyületet - ahol az általános képletekben A kémiai kötés vagy szerves csoport, U szerves csoport, és Q jelentése általános képletű csoport, amelyben R1, R2 és Hetjelentése az (I) általános képletnél meghatározott - és adott esetbena (IIa) vagy (IIb) általános képletű vegyület E/Z<> izomereit, E/Zizomerkeverékeit és/vagy tautomereit szabad formában vagy só formábanhidrolizálják. A találmány tárgyát képezi továbbá a (IIa), (IIb),(IIIa) és (IIIb) általános képletű intermedierek előállítási eljárása. ezekben a képletekben A és U jelentése az előzőkben megadott, és Tjelentése amelyben R2 jelentése az előzőkben megadott.
